Multiple Apartment Fires Cause Chaos and Injuries in Charlotte, Memphis, and Spartanburg

Firefighters successfully extinguished a large two-alarm fire at a south Charlotte apartment complex, with smoke and flames visible upon their arrival. Over 50 firefighters were called to the scene and controlled the blaze within an hour. Two firefighters sustained minor injuries, while no civilians were harmed. The cause of the fire is currently under investigation, and the American Red Cross has been notified.

Hampden Fire: 10 Homes Affected in 2-Alarm Blaze.

A two-alarm fire in Hampden affected as many as 10 homes, leaving one person injured with minor burns. Firefighters are investigating the cause of the fire, which started in the 800 block of Union Avenue. The homes affected by the fire or heavy smoke are being checked for extensions and boarded up to protect people's valuables. Traffic in the area will be affected throughout the morning.

Multiple House Fires in Cumberland and Preble Counties Result in Injuries and Losses

Two firefighters were injured in a two-alarm fire that occurred in Upper Allen Township, Cumberland County. The fire started in the garage and spread to the house. Firefighters were told that two children were trapped, but they were found safely outside. The garage collapsed, causing two firefighters to become trapped. They were extracted with minor injuries and transported to the hospital. The cause of the fire is unknown, and State Police will be investigating.
